Rahuri is a city located in the Ahmednagar district of Maharashtra, India. It is situated about 69 kilometers north of Pune and 300 kilometers east of Mumbai. Known for its historical and cultural significance, Rahuri has become an important center for agriculture and education in the region. With its pleasant climate, rich heritage, and vibrant festivals, Rahuri attracts visitors from all over the country.
Rahuri is a city that boasts a rich historical background. It was under the rule of the Marathas and later became a part of the British Empire. The city is often associated with the glorious Maratha warrior,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j, who had a significant influence in this region during his reign. One can find several ancient forts and temples with intricate architecture, serving as a testimony to the city's glorious past.
Rahuri is primarily an agricultural area and is widely known as the "Sugar Bowl of Maharashtra." The region is highly fertile and has made notable contributions to the sugar industry in the state. The city also serves as a major trading hub for various agricultural commodities, including cotton, onion, and soybean.
In addition to its agricultural significance, Rahuri is also home to numerous educational institutions. The city houses one of the largest agricultural universities in Asia, Mahatma Phule Krishi Vidyapeeth (MPKV). This esteemed university offers courses in agriculture, horticulture, and veterinary sciences, attracting students from all over India.
Rahuri is also known for its colorful festivals and cultural events. The most prominent festival celebrated here is Ganesh Chaturthi, during which the city comes alive with vibrant processions, music, and dance. Another famous festival is Pola, a celebration dedicated to farmers and their cattle, where they decorate and worship their livestock.
With its pleasant climate, the city of Rahuri offers a tranquil environment for both residents and visitors. The picturesque landscapes, surrounding hills, and lush green fields make it an ideal destination for nature enthusiasts and photographers. Visitors can also explore nearby attractions such as the famous Ram Mandir, Talabela Fort, and the beautiful Ghodegaon Dam.

1. Melghat Tiger Reserve - This is located in the Amravati district and is a popular wildlife sanctuary known for its rich biodiversity and the presence of tigers, leopards, and sloth bears.
2. Ajanta Caves - These ancient Buddhist cave temples in Aurangabad are a UNESCO World Heritage Site and showcase exquisite rock-cut sculptures and paintings.
3. Ellora Caves - Also located in Aurangabad, the Ellora Caves are another UNESCO World Heritage Site known for their remarkable rock-cut architecture and sculptures representing Hindu, Buddhist, and Jain faiths.
4. Shirdi - Known as the home of the famous spiritual leader Sai Baba, Shirdi attracts millions of devotees each year. The Sai Baba Temple is a significant landmark in the town.
5. Nashik - Nashik, located on the banks of the Godavari River, is a historical city known for its temples and as a major center for the Hindu pilgrimage of Kumbh Mela.
6. Bhandardara - This hill station near Igatpuri offers scenic beauty with waterfalls, lakes, and mountains. It is a perfect place for nature lovers and adventure activities like trekking and camping.
7. Vaijanath Temple, Parli - The ancient Vaijanath Temple in Parli is one of the 12 Jyotirlinga shrines dedicated to Lord Shiva. It is a significant religious site for devotees.
